Mad Rock got started in 2002, producing highly technical, well-made and affordable rock climbing shoes. Being owned and operated by avid rock climbers, Mad Rock was already ahead of the game when it came to producing functional gear that even the most seasoned climbers would appreciate. Today, Mad Rock has sold well over a million pairs of climbing shoes, and still continues to innovate and expand. Products from Mad Rock besides climbing shoes now include mountaineering boots, harnesses, chalk bags, quickdraws, crash pads and climbing accessories. According to Mad Rock, innovation isn't just a word - it's a challenge to be met daily. For that reason, Mad Rock uses the latest materials and up-to-date technologies while striving to maintain the superior quality and functionality of their climbing shoes, chalk bags and gear.

4.0 out of 5 stars. SizingReviewed by Trad Climber from Adirondacks on Wednesday, July 28, 2021This is a review only regarding the sizing of these shoes--I have yet to climb in them and therefore cannot comment on their performance. The four stars above are therefore meaningless.
I recently purchased a number of sizes of this shoe for our organization's climbing supplies. The first thing I noticed was the length of the shoe, and therefore tried on a couple of pairs to see how they fit. In short, a women's size 12 Lyra (marked on the box as a 44 Euro) is approximately the same length as my size 41 (Euro) LaSportiva Miura. Now, the Lyra is much higher volume and has a more aggressive toe, meaning I could curl my toes more than I typically do in the Miura, but nevertheless, I felt that were I to wear these shoes, I would be in a 43 Lyra (size 11 W) at best, whereas the size 41 Miura is rather roomy--when I am looking for higher performance, I wear a 40 or 40.5.
All this said, I am often a slab and crack climber and so don't love higher volume shoes with downward pointed toes and so the fit of the Lyra felt a bit different to me than my standard fare. -
